Microsoft Windows Server 2022

Windows Server 2022 services using Local System that use Negotiate when reverting to NTLM authentication must use the computer identity instead of authenticating anonymously

STIG ID: WN22-SO-000260 | SRG: SRG-OS-000480-GPOS-00227 | Severity: Medium | CCI: CCI-000366 | Vulnerability ID: V-254470

Description

Services using Local System that use Negotiate when reverting to NTLM authentication may gain unauthorized access if allowed to authenticate anonymously versus using the computer identity.

Check

C-57955r849224_chk

If the following registry value does not exist or is not configured as specified, this is a finding:Registry Hive: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INERegistry Path: \S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\LSA\Value Name: UseMachineIdType: REG_DWORDValue: 0x00000001 (1)

Fix

F-57906r849225_fix

Configure the policy value for Computer Configuration >> Windows Settings >> Security Settings >> Local Policies >> Security Options >> Network security: Allow Local System to use computer identity for NTLM to "Enabled".
